Profiles/Favorite Bands/Ratings.

Gotta couple ideas stewing in my head that I think could make this site even more user friendly. Allow an option to create individual profiles so that we log in and can start adding bands to our "favorites" section. This section can be a banner/widget/something that's always sectioned away at a portion of the site for quick reference, even immediately from the homepage. Either along the top, or on the right side, or bottom, etc.

Ahh, I see now that I've created a profile here to post this idea, the homepage reflects this idea to an extent. Well then, in the spirit of this message, "If you have any ideas for future members features, please let me know," I think you should display the "Log In/Register" on the main page to let people know that it's possible. At present, there's nothing displayed and I didn't think you could log in to the main page. Post a brief caption beneath the "Log In/Register" links to describe the benefits, including bookmarking favorite bands and songs, and hopefully "rating:"

I would think 3 rating options would be good enough. Either Great, Average, or Poor, or 1-3 stars. In my mind, a 3 star rating would describe a track where the guitars were removed from the original, so it's something of an exact copy. I think vocal-less versions could qualify as well, because Karaoke is good fun. Average might be normal submissions that don't really sound authentic, or are lacking key supporting instruments, etc. This might be a good way to quickly identify which of the 5 versions of Megadeth's Holy Wars is best, etc. (And 1-star is for the "why would you submit this?" versions.) This gives the user a little more control than youtube to differentiate "I like it, but it's not the best version" from "I like it; it was perfect," which a simple 2 star or thumbs up/down approach limits you to, as I'd likely have to thumbs-down an imperfect version that I still might like, so as to separate it from what I think is the best version.

Just expanding on the "favorites" thought, maybe for the favorite artists section, we'd have a separate #-A-Z section that are collapsible/expandable. Maybe if I only have bands chosen as my favorites under the letters D, I, and M, those are the only three letters that pop up. This might save space so that the webpage wouldn't need to scroll down forever.

That's all for now. Cheers. Love the site.
